# Strings in the evaluator carry a so-called `context' (the ATermList)
# which is a list of strings representing store paths. This is to
# allow users to write things like
#
# "--with-freetype2-library=" + freetype + "/lib"
#
# where `freetype' is a derivation (or a source to be copied to the
# store). If we just concatenated the strings without keeping track
# of the referenced store paths, then if the string is used as a
# derivation attribute, the derivation will not have the correct
# dependencies in its inputDrvs and inputSrcs.
#
# The semantics of the context is as follows: when a string with
# context C is used as a derivation attribute, then the derivations in
# C will be added to the inputDrvs of the derivation, and the other
# store paths in C will be added to the inputSrcs of the derivations.
#
# For canonicity, the store paths should be in sorted order.
Str | string ATermList | Expr |
Str | string | Expr | ObsoleteStr
# Internal to the parser, doesn't occur in ASTs.
IndStr | string | Expr |
# A path is a reference to a file system object that is to be copied
# to the Nix store when used as a derivation attribute. When it is
# concatenated to a string (i.e., `str + path'), it is also copied and
# the resulting store path is concatenated to the string (with the
# store path in the context). If a string or path is concatenated to
# a path (i.e., `path + str' or `path + path'), the result is a new
# path (if the right-hand side is a string, the context must be
# empty).
